Purdy contract extension coming soon?

The 49ers have made it a habit of making contract extension talks last until the summer and nearly training camp. However, it appears that they could have a deal done as early as before the start of the offseason program this month.

Kicker competition coming

Kicker Jake Moody struggled last season. The 49ers plan to add competition for home this offseason.

Starting center job not up for grabs

While the 49ers are looking to add competition for several positions, it appears one job is secure. Starting center Jake Brendel is not in danger of losing his starting job, especially when the Niners have other positions to address on the offensive line this offseason.

No Super Bowl talk for Shanahan

The Niners had big expectations last season but ended up in last place in the NFC West. While still considered a likely competitor for the postseason and perhaps a championship, head coach Kyle Shanahan is staying present in each phase. He isn't getting ahead of himself.

Niners among cap space leaders

With the moves the 49ers have done this offseason, they are now ranked sixth in the league in cap space at more than $33 million.
